What are some common challenges faced by Customer Success Managers and how can they be addressed?

Customer Success Managers often face the challenge of balancing the needs of their clients with the goals of their company. Managing multiple accounts, each with unique requirements, can be demanding, especially when trying to ensure high customer satisfaction and retention rates. Effective time management, proactive communication, and leveraging customer data analytics are key strategies to overcome these challenges. Additionally, collaborating closely with sales, support, and product teams helps ensure client feedback is heard and acted upon, leading to better outcomes for all parties involved.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Customer Success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Customer Success Manager, you need strong relationship management skills, a deep understanding of your company's products or services, and typically a bachelor's degree in business or a related field. Experience with CRM platforms like Salesforce, customer engagement tools, and data analysis systems is highly valued. Exceptional communication, problem-solving, and empathy are crucial soft skills for building trust and resolving client issues effectively. These skills ensure customers achieve their goals, which drives satisfaction, retention, and overall business growth.

What are Success Managers?

Success Managers, often called Customer Success Managers (CSMs), are professionals responsible for building strong relationships with clients and ensuring they achieve their desired outcomes using a company's products or services. They act as the main point of contact after a sale, guiding customers through onboarding, training, and ongoing support. Success Managers focus on customer satisfaction, retention, and helping clients maximize value, which in turn supports business growth. Their role often involves proactive communication, problem-solving, and collaborating with other internal teams to address customer needs.

Job description

Department: Client Success 

Reports To: Director of Client Success / New & Emerging Markets 

Locations: Open to one of the following offices - Billings, MT, Oklahoma City, OK, Houston, TX, Dallas, TX, Austin, TX, or San Antonio, TX 

FLSA Status: Exempt 

 Position Summary 

The Client Success Specialist (CSS) serves as the primary guide for new clients during their onboarding journey. This role is responsible for delivering a seamless, high-touch experience from contract execution through the successful completion of the client’s first two payrolls in Darwin. 
The CSS acts as the bridge between Sales, Benefits, Payroll Operations, and the long-term service team, ensuring accuracy, communication, and confidence during a client’s transition to our services. A critical component of this role includes training clients on myHR system functionality to ensure adoption, confidence, and operational efficiency from day one. 

Key Responsibilities 

  • Lead new clients through the full onboarding lifecycle, establishing timelines and clear expectations. 

  • Ensure all required documentation is received prior to onboarding launch. 

  • Serve as the primary point of contact during implementation. 

  • Build and prepare client payroll setup in Darwin. 

  • Process and validate the first two payrolls with accuracy and timeliness. 

  • Audit payroll data to ensure compliance and alignment with client expectations. 

  • Conduct structured training sessions on myHR system functionality including payroll approvals, onboarding workflows, reporting, and administrative tools. 

  • Provide live demonstrations and reinforce system best practices to drive adoption. 

  • Partner closely with Sales to ensure a smooth and well-documented transition. 

  • Coordinate with Benefits Consultants and Benefits Operations (BOP) to ensure benefit setup is accurate prior to first payroll. 

  • Deliver high-touch client education across payroll, benefits, and system workflows. 

  • Prepare a comprehensive and well-documented handoff to the long-term service team. 

Qualifications 

  • 3–5 years of payroll, PEO, HR, or client onboarding experience. 

  • Experience processing payroll in complex or multi-state environments preferred. 

  • Experience training clients on HRIS or payroll systems (myHR experience preferred). 

  • Strong understanding of benefit implementation timelines. 

  • Excellent project management and organizational skills. 

  • Exceptional communication and client-facing abilities. 

  • High attention to detail and process orientation.
